The Expression Of PD-1/PD-L1 In HNSCC Tissues And The Expression And Dynamic Changes Of SPD-L1 In Peripheral Blood

Objective:To detect the expression of programmed death-ligand receptor-1(PD-1)and programmed cell death ligand-1(PD-L1)in head and neck squamous cell carcinoma(HNSCC),and to explore the role of PD-1/PD-L1 in HNSCC;To detect the expression level of soluble PD-L1(sPD-L1),to analyze the correlation with the expression level of PD-1/PD-L1 in tumor tissue,and to compare the dynamic changes of sPD-L1 expression level after treatment,to explore its significance;To analyze the relationship between the expression level of PD-L1 and PD-1 in HNSCC tissue and clinicopathological features;To explore the effect of induction chemotherapy on the expression level of PD-L1 and PD-1 in HNSCC tissue.Methods:62 cases of head and neck squamous cell carcinoma were divided into direct operation group(n=32)and induction chemotherapy followed by operation group(n=30).The expression levels of PD-L1 and PD-1 in postoperative HNSCC tissues were detected by immunohistochemical staining,and compared with the expression levels of PD-L1 and PD-1 in normal tissues adjacent to cancer,to explore the role of PD-1/PD-L1 in HNSCC at tissue level.The expression of sPD-L1 in peripheral blood was detected by enzyme-linked immunosorbent assay(ELISA)before and after treatment.The correlation between the expression of sPD-L1 before treatment and the expression of PD-1/PD-L1 in tumor tissue was analyzed,and the dynamic changes of sPD-L1 expression after induction chemotherapy and/or operation were compared to explore its significance.The clinical data of 62 patients were retrospectively analyzed,combined with the expression levels of PD-L1 and PD-1 in HNSCC tissues,the relationship between the expression levels of PD-L1 and PD-1 in HNSCC tissues and clinicopathological features was analyzed,and the differences of PD-L1 and PD-1 expressions in HNSCC tissues of the two groups were compared to explore the effect of induction chemotherapy on the expression levels of PD-L1 and PD-1 in HNSCC tissues.Results:The positive rates of PD-1 and PDL1 in HNSCC tissues were higher than those in adjacent normal tissues(P<0.01);There was no significant correlation between the serum sPD-L1 values of HNSCC patients and the expression of PD-1 and PD-L1 in HNSCC tissues(P=0.280,0.465).There was no significant change in the expression of sPD-L1 before and after induction chemotherapy in HNSCC patients,but the expression level of sPD-L1 in HNSCC patients after operation was lower than that before operation(P<0.01).The expression levels of PD-1 and PD-L1 in HNSCC tissues were correlated with clinical stage and lymph node metastasis(P<0.01),while induction chemotherapy had no significant effect on the expression levels of PD-1 and PD-L1 in HNSCC tissues(P=0.829,0.840).Conclusion:PD-1 and PDL1 are highly expressed in HNSCC,and the expression levels are related to clinical stage and lymph node metastasis.PD-1 and PD-L1 may be the targets of immunotherapy for HNSCC,but there is no significant correlation between serum sPD-L1 and the expression of PD-1 and PD-L1 in HNSCC before treatment.The expression level of sPD-L1 in HNSCC patients decreased after operation,which is an important biomarker of HNSCC,and its expression level may play an important role in evaluating the efficacy of HNSCC patients.Induction chemotherapy has no significant effect on the expression levels of PD-1 and PD-L1 in HNSCC tissues.
